WFJ Duty Free recently opened its duty-free shop at Terminal 2 of the Beijing Capital International Airport on February 11.
The shop, situated in the isolation area for international arrivals and departures of Terminal 2, offers popular duty-free goods of world-renowned brands, including perfumes, cosmetics, liquor, digital products, and various travel essentials. China's liquor, beloved cultural products (such as China-chic panda toys) as well as high-quality digital and technological products can all be found here. Right now, the shop supports a multilingual payment system with interfaces in Chinese, English, and several other languages. It will further expand its language support based on flight schedules and passengers' nationalities.
